Movie Overview: Dead Air

MovieDead Air
Release Year2007
DirectorXavier Lee Pak-Tat
GenreHorror / Thriller
Runtime88 minutes
LanguageCN

🎭 Cast & Character Study

The performances in Dead Air are led by Derek Tsang Kwok-Cheung . The supporting cast, including Leila Tong and Terence Yin Chi-Wai , provides the necessary layers to the central narrative.
